Most Android-x86 projects have moved toward 64-bit (x86_64) to support modern apps and hardware. However, many older machines—like early Intel Atom tablets—feature or processors that cannot handle 64-bit instructions.

Use alternative app marketplaces like Aurora Store or F-Droid . Aurora Store allows you to spoof your device profile to ensure you only download 32-bit arm-v7a or x86 compatible applications. Conclusion
